function countBodyChildren() {
var body_element=document.getElementsByTagName("body")[0];
alert(body_element.childNodes.length);
}
window.onload=countBodyChildren;
window.onload=countBodyChildren();
在使用onload事件處理函數時,加括號和不加括號有什麼區別?
初學JavaScript,請老師指教,多謝!
簡答的講,加括號的表示調用這個方法,不加括號表示賦值。
所以window.onload=countBodyChildren; 是對的,第二個應該是錯的。